Battle Creek curbside bulk waste collection resumes Monday

BATTLE CREEK, Mich. — Battle Creek says they're re-starting their bulk curbside waste collection Monday after a hiatus due to COVID-19.

The city says people living within the city limits can place their bulk waste on the curb the same day as their normal trash pickup.

They describe bulk waste as furniture, mattresses, appliances, rolled carpet in four-foot lengths, and similar items.

As for yard waste pickup, the city says waste management is running a day behind but they think this will pick up starting next week.

They ask that you put your leaves, downed branches and other yard waste in specially marked containers, paper yard waste bags, or tied into four-foot bundles. They say these bags should weigh 50 pounds or less and if you leave these on the curb this week they will get to them.

Waste management says they paused bulk pickup and postponed yard waste pickup to reduce the number of on-the-road staff.
